  30. Pride in the fact you are not a coffee drinker? Why? Coffee has been shown to benefit health in many studies. It's definitely not bad for you (in moderation of course). What IS bad for you is drinking coffee from a Keurig. That's not real coffee, that's old, stale grounds that produces mildly flavored water that comes from pods that are an environmental nightmare. JMHO, of course..... Get some good whole beans from a local roaster, grind them at home, and use a simple pour-over method. If you are not used to the caffeine kick, you might start with half regular and half decaf beans. You don't have to get as technical as these folks, but here's a link to show you the basics... Enjoy. https://www.stumptowncoffee.com/blog/how-to-perfect-pour-over
